About the role
Netomnia is the UK's fourth-largest Full Fibre network, and our marketing team is expanding its creative capability. We're looking for a sharp, self-motivated freelance designer to become our go-to creative hands: someone who can turn a brief into a polished web page, a scroll-stopping social campaign, or a punchy 30–60 second video.
This is a compact, high-trust role, four focused hours a day, real ownership, and creative variety across web, social and video. It suits a designer who wants a steady, guaranteed retainer and the chance to build a varied portfolio, without the commitment of a full-time role.
What you'll be doing
- Designing and maintaining website pages; layouts, banners, landing pages, on-page visual updates and general UX improvement
- Creating assets for social and campaign activity, always aligned to brand guidelines
- Producing marketing collateral; one-pagers, brochures, presentation templates and sales support material
- Creating short-form video content (30 seconds – 1 minute) for social and YouTube, including captions, transitions and thumbnails
- Working from briefs issued in ClickUp, turning them around within agreed timelines
- Partnering closely with the Campaign & Content Manager on visual consistency, and with the development team on implementing web pages
What you'll bring
- A strong portfolio spanning web/digital design, social creative and short-form video editing
- Confidence working independently and managing your own time within a focused daily window
- Sharp eye for brand consistency and attention to detail under quick turnarounds
- Comfortable taking a brief and running with it; proactive, not just reactive
- B2B, tech, telecom or infrastructure sector experience is a bonus, not a requirement
Tools you'll use
- Adobe Creative Cloud; Photoshop, Illustrator, Premiere Pro / Premiere Rush
- Figma or Canva Pro; for web pages, social templates and rapid collateral design
- Clipchamp or Adobe Premiere for short-form video editing, captions and transitions
- CapCut or Canva Video; useful for fast-turnaround, social-native video edits
- ClickUp for receiving briefs and tracking work with the marketing team
- Basic familiarity with a CMS (e.g. Strapi, WordPress or similar) is a plus for web page updates
